An OHSU study just published in a medical journal may have uncovered key evidence linking Alzheimer’s disease and traumatic brain injuries and, more importantly, hinted at a way both can be addressed medically according to a recent article in The Oregonian.
According to the newspaper, a scientific paper prepared by OHSU and a university in New York “discovered that a traumatic brain injury fouls up the brain’s waste removal system, causing toxic proteins to build up among the cells. A similar phenomenon exists with Alzheimer’s.” The article goes on to note that if TBI and Alzheimer’s do, indeed, stem from similar chemical causes then there is “hope that scientists will find a drug one day to slow the development of Alzheimer’s or neurodegeneration after a brain injury.”
According to The Oregonian’s account of the study, the breakthrough lies in the discovery of “the brain’s waste removal system.” It continues: “Scientists had long suspected that the brain, which is separated from the body by a protective blood-brain barrier, had a mechanism for flushing out waste. But they did not have a clue about the process.” Now, they do. Another important feature of the study is its identification of the failure of this waste-flushing process as the core cause of both Alzheimer’s and of many traumatic brain injuries – a link between the two conditions that has long been suspected but has been difficult to prove scientifically.
